Urban families tended to be smaller than rural families due to factors such as higher cost of living in cities, limited living space, and greater access to family planning services. Additionally, urban families may prioritize career and professional development over having a large number of children.
Factors such as industrialization, job opportunities in urban centers, better access to education and healthcare, and the promise of a higher standard of living were key reasons for families leaving rural areas to move to cities.
